WebJun 27, 2024 · The ladder logic programming example uses the M1 START push button input to activate the M1 RUN output. The M1 RUN output is used a second time to latch the M1 RUN output. Both M1 STOP and M1 TOL are wired normally closed (NC) to the PLC inputs and thus need to be configured as normally open (NO) symbols in the logic. WebMotor actions carried out with a particular body side (e.g., throwing a ball right-handed) are controlled by the contralateral hemisphere (e.g., left hemisphere). Similarly, visual sensory input entering the eyes from the left (right) visual field is transmitted, via the optic chiasm, for further processing toward the right (left) visual cortex.
